Easy Cinnamon Roll Casserole Recipe

  • Author: Kimberly
  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 40 minutes
  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ings
  • Category: Breakfast, Brunch
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: American
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Ingredients

Cinnamon Roll Casserole:

  • 2 cans (12.4 oz each) refrigerated cinnamon rolls with icing
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1/4 cup maple syrup
  • 1 tbsp ground cinnamon
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/4 cup chopped pecans (optional)
  • nonstick cooking spray


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with nonstick spray.
  2. Prepare the rolls: Cut each cinnamon roll into quarters and spread them in the baking dish.
  3. Mix the custard: Whisk together eggs, heavy cream, maple syrup, cinnamon, and vanilla. Pour over the cinnamon rolls.
  4. Add toppings: Sprinkle chopped pecans over the casserole if desired.
  5. Bake: Bake for 35–40 minutes until golden and set.
  6. Finish: Let cool slightly, then drizzle with included icing before serving.

Notes

  • For a richer flavor, use half-and-half or add nutmeg.
  • Enjoy with fresh fruit or extra maple syrup for serving.
